Austroads is looking for a Senior GIS (Geospatial Information System) Engineer to deliver geospatial services and administration within the Austroads Data and Analytics team.
Based in Melbourne and working in a small team, the Senior GIS Engineer will implement and maintain GIS capabilities and develop spatio-temporal insights for Austroads/TCA, its members and other government agencies.
The required works will be undertaken in a project driven environment with a strong focus on adherence to quality systems.
The role is responsible for:
- Technical leadership for the implementation, development and maintenance of telematics and spatio-temporal insights capability.
- Providing hands-on geospatial system administration services where required.
- Representing the team as a trusted service provider, working closely with internal and external customers to understand, document and solve their geospatial needs.
- Assisting in the publication of technical reports and papers.
- Managing multiple competing priorities in a changing environment.
- Liaising and providing technical assistance for internal staff, members and other stakeholders as required.
- Applying professional and technical expertise to mentor staff, resolve technical issues, and to prepare and edit reports, submissions, papers and correspondence as directed.
- Developing and maintaining documentation of processes and procedures to support the introduction of new initiatives.
- Exercising diligence when making decisions, adhering to the requirements outlined in the Delegations of Authority.
- Maintaining and adhering to Quality Systems processes and procedures.
